Yesterday, Jan. 14, Gil Derouen, Jim Anderson, and Charles Moore birded some water areas in Sullivan County. Highlights, beginning along the "north" side of Boone Lake, along Minga, Hamilton, Muddy Creek, Sugar Hollow, and Buffalo Rds, including the Davis Marina:
Hooded Merganser           2
Pied-billed Grebe          5
Killdeer                   1
Ring-billed Gull           3
Kingfisher                 1
Am. Kestrel                1
Along this stretch, we saw at least 26 White-tailed Deer:
Minga Rd.                    12
Hamilton Rd.                  3
Buffalo Rd                  Herds of 5 and 6

Weir Dam:
Wigeon                       2
Bufflehead                 155
Great Blue Heron             1
Ruby-crowned Kinglet         1
Golden-crowned Kinglet       1

Rooty Branch Rd. Beaver Pond:
Gadwall                      3
Mallard                     95
Kingfisher                   2

Pemberton Rd.:
Am. Kestrel                  2

At Musick's Campground, we met Rick Kight, Glen Eller, and Pete Range, who were already there.
Rick previously posted a report on the birds we saw there.

Middlebrook Lake:
Redhead                     1
Ring-necked Duck           18
Hooded Merganser          178
Pied-billed Grebe           2
Bald Eagle (imm.)           1
Great Blue Heron            3
Ring-billed Gull          700 est.
Bonaparte's Gull            3
Coot                       12

In our discussions with Glen and Pete, they reported Black Ducks and 2 male Pintails at Rooty Branch Rd Beaver Pond
and Herring Gulls at Middlebrook Lake, in addition to what we saw.
